All-State Academic Team for Froess
A Columbia High School senior was listed among the Illinois High School Association’s 26 students selected to be a part of the 2025 IHSA All-State Academic Team.
Honorees will be recognized at a banquet in Bloomington on April 13.
Chosen as a member of the IHSA 2024-25 All-State Academic Team Honorable Mention is Columbia’s Paige Froess.
Froess is a key member of the CHS softball squad. She hit .444 last season with two home runs and 28 RBIs in addition to posting a 6-4 record with a 2.58 ERA in the pitching circle.
Froess also played on the CHS girls basketball squad this season.

Every IHSA member school was invited to nominate one female student and one male student to be a part of this prestigious team. Nominees needed to possess a minimum 3.50 grade point average on a 4.0 scale after their seventh semester, have participated in at least two IHSA sponsored sports or activities during each of the last two years of high school, and demonstrated outstanding citizenship.
The nominations were evaluated by a committee up of IHSA principals, athletic directors, and activities directors. One male winner and one female winner from each of the seven IHSA Board of Directors Divisions were selected initially, while the final 12 spots on the team were then rounded out with at-large candidates from anywhere in the state.
